4 Speed Trans, 6 Cyl 258, Dana 300 Transfer Case. Dana 44 Front, 20 Rear, The Following : New Installed Bell Crank Clutch Linkage Assy, Exhaust, Brakes ,shocks , Stock Leaf Springs Front & Rear, Poly Shackle Kits, Upgraded One Piece G2 Rear Axle Kit, Engine And Trans Mounts, Goodyear Wranglers 90%, Fresh Wheel Bearing Pack & All Drivetrain Fluids Changed, New Windshield And Lower Windshield Frame Gasket, New Sony Sound W/in Dash And Rear Polk Speakers, Best Bikini Top Used Condition, Original Hardtop W/ Doors , Tow Hitch, And Tow Bar, And Full Water Prof Cover (c.b.radio & Antenna Not Included ) All Systems In Working Order On This Stock Gem ... Keep In Mind, This Jeep Is 31 Years Old And I May Have Forgotten Some Things. It Shows And Drives Well. Although It Has Normal Wear And Imperfections Thats Standard For Jeeps Of This Age . Chips And Patina In The Original Finish, Small Dent In The Hood, And A Couple Of Rust Spots. Tennis Ball Size Hole Patched In Driver Side Floor Pan,and A Burn In L/h Rear Carpet. Jeep recalling 75,000 Cherokees over air-conditioning lines
Tue, Oct 27 2015Fiat Chrysler Automobiles has issued a recall for an estimated 75,364 examples of the Jeep Cherokee in the United States. The problem stems from an air-conditioning line, which may have been installed to close to the exhaust manifold. "Under certain operating conditions," says FCA in the statement below, "this may pose a fire risk." Thus far, however, the company says it is "unaware of any related injuries or accidents." The owners of those 75k Jeeps (as well as another 18,000+ in other markets) can expect to hear from their local dealers to have the problem rectified. However the manufacturer also advises owners to watch out for indicators like air-conditioning loss or a dashboard warning light and contact their dealers if necessary. Related Video: Statement: Air-conditioning System October 27, 2015 , Auburn Hills, Mich. - FCA US LLC is voluntarily recalling an estimated 75,364 U.S.-market SUVs to inspect and replace, as required, their air-conditioning lines, as required. FCA US launched an investigation after the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ration received two customer complaints involving smoke and fire. The Company discovered air-conditioning lines on some vehicles may have been installed in close proximity to their engines' exhaust manifolds; under certain operating conditions, this may pose a fire risk. FCA US is unaware of any related injuries or accidents. The recall is limited to certain 2015 Jeep Cherokees. Additional vehicles are affected in other markets. They include an estimated 7,571 in Canada; 4,018 in Mexico; and 6,942 outside the outside the NAFTA region. Affected customers will be advised when they may schedule service, which FCA US will provide free of charge. . Customers who observe air-conditioning loss or any other concern, such as a dashboard warning light, should contact their dealers. WWII Jeep 'found in crate' set to cross Greenwich auction block
Thu, 30 May 2013Fans of old military vehicles might want to pay extra close attention to the Greenwich Concours d'Elegance coming up this weekend. Crossing the Bonhams auction block on Sunday are a pair of seemingly flawless World War II Jeeps, which are both expected to fetch serious dollars.
Lot Number 305 at the auction is a 1945 Ford GPW Jeep that has been fully restored, which is expected to command between $35,000 and $45,000. Shortly after the Ford GPW, a potentially more interesting 1944 Willys MB (shown above) will be auctioned off, but Hemmings raises some red flags about this Jeep. First, it is claiming to have been "discovered in its original crate about 30 years ago," but there is no proof or documentation of any sort. Also, it is claiming to be all original, but it was given a paint job "shortly after it was discovered." Even with these questionable descriptions, this Willys could reach between $20,000 and $30,000. Head over to Bonhams' site and Hemmings for more information on both WW2-era Jeeps.
